I have a trial version of Jira Software. I'm trying to do a little setup to test it out.
We have 2 departments: Projects and Managed Services.
Projects - 1 client, multiple team members, due dates, tasks to be completed are managed at a high level
Managed Services - 1 client, usually 1 team member, list of specific tasks, not date driven, managed at the detailed task level
The same person can be on both a project and a managed service, so we all need access to both.
What is the best solution for us? Can we use Jira Software with 2 templates?

Of course you can use Jira, but my question is why you want to have two different projects for that. Can't you use one project with e.g. task issue type as a high level and subtasks issue type as the detailed task? Imo, I wouldn't use different containers (projects) if there wasn't any specific requirement for this.
We track different fields on the tasks when they are projects vs managed services. This is exactly what I'm trying to figure out. Do I need to use 2 templates and if so, can I?

You can use as many projects as you like, all created with different templates. Your users can be added to as many as they need to be (the licence count is by "can log in", not by project)
